Free Printable Valentine’s Day Tracing Worksheets for Preschoolers

Tracing is one of the most important first steps in learning how to write. Before children can form letters independently, they need to develop the fine motor control to follow a line and control a pencil.

With Valentine’s Day approaching, we have created a set of 8 Free Printable Tracing Worksheets to make handwriting practice fun and festive!

These A4 PDF templates are designed specifically for preschoolers and kindergarteners. Each sheet features a large holiday image to trace, followed by the word written on handwriting lines. This “picture to word” connection helps kids understand that the letters they are tracing have meaning.

How to Use These Worksheets Effectively

Finger Trace First: Before giving your child a pencil, have them trace the dotted lines with their index finger. This helps them learn the “path of motion” without the pressure of holding a tool.

Pencils & Crayons: Have them trace the picture and the word at the bottom using a pencil. Afterward, let them color in their drawing with crayons or markers!

Read Aloud: Point to the word at the bottom (e.g., “Cupid”) and read it together. Trace the letters one by one, saying the sound each letter makes.

Reusable Option: Slide these sheets into a plastic page protector and let your child use a dry erase marker. This way, they can practice over and over again!
